Who Am I?

I am a Licensed Professional Counselor. I have a B.A. in Psychology with a minor in Spanish from Butler University and an M.A. in Clinical Mental Health Counseling from Northwestern University. My therapeutic approach is built upon a foundational, trusting relationship with clients. I integrate non-directive play therapy, narrative therapy and relational cultural therapy to tailor my approach for each client. I am focused on working with children in crisis and helping them and their families achieve collaborative goals through a safe, growth-fostering relationship.

HOW I HELP

I help by creating a safe, affirming space where clients feel seen, heard, and valued. Drawing from relational-cultural therapy, I emphasize the power of connection and shared experiences in healing. I use play-based interventions to encourage creative expression and emotional processing, particularly for children and those who communicate best through action. With a person-centered approach, I ensure that therapy is guided by each client’s unique strengths, needs, and goals.

By blending these approaches, I support individuals in building resilience, deepening relationships, and fostering personal growth in a way that feels authentic and empowering.

What it’s like in a session with me

Every session is shaped by the unique needs and comfort level of my client. I prioritize creating a safe and welcoming space where individuals feel respected, heard, and empowered. From the very first session, I focus on meeting clients where they are, honoring their personal boundaries, and moving at a pace that feels right for them.

Sessions may involve talking, creative expression, or play-based techniques, depending on what feels most natural and effective. Whether we are exploring emotions, processing experiences, or building coping strategies, my goal is to create a space where clients feel free to express themselves without judgment. Therapy is a collaborative process, and I work alongside each client to support their growth in a way that aligns with their personal needs and goals.
